Understanding the Ideal Temperature for Cooking Ham to Perfection

Cooking ham to the right temperature is crucial not only for achieving the perfect flavor and texture but also for ensuring food safety. Ham, being a cured meat, has specific cooking requirements that depend on its type and whether it is pre-cooked or raw. In this article, we will delve into the world of ham, exploring the different types, their cooking requirements, and the importance of reaching the right internal temperature to enjoy a delicious and safe meal.

Introduction to Ham and Its Varieties

Ham is a versatile and popular meat that can be found in many cuisines around the world. It is typically made from the hind leg of a pig, which is cured with salt or sugar and then smoked, aged, or cooked. The process of curing and the method of cooking can significantly affect the final product’s taste, texture, and appearance. There are several types of ham, including but not limited to:

  • Prosciutto: An Italian dry-cured ham that is known for its delicate flavor.
  • Serrano Ham: A Spanish cured ham that is similar to prosciutto but often has a nuttier flavor.
  • Black Forest Ham: A German ham that is smoked and cured, giving it a distinctive flavor.
  • Glazed Ham: Often used in American and British cuisine, this ham is coated with a mixture of sugar, spices, and sometimes mustard before baking.

Cooking Requirements for Different Types of Ham

The cooking requirements for ham largely depend on whether the ham is pre-cooked or raw. Pre-cooked hams are those that have been already cooked during the curing process and just need to be warmed up before serving. Raw hams, on the other hand, require more thorough cooking to ensure they reach a safe internal temperature.

Cooking Pre-Cooked Ham

Pre-cooked hams are a convenient option for special occasions or everyday meals. They can be glazed and then baked in the oven or cooked in a slow cooker. The key is to heat the ham to an internal temperature that is safe to eat while also ensuring it stays moist and flavorful. For pre-cooked hams, the internal temperature should reach 140°F (60°C) to ensure food safety.

Cooking Raw Ham

Raw hams need to be cooked thoroughly to an internal temperature of 145°F (63°C), followed by a 3-minute rest time. This ensures that any bacteria present are killed, making the ham safe to eat. Raw hams can be roasted in the oven, and the cooking time will depend on the size and type of the ham.

Importance of Internal Temperature in Cooking Ham

Achieving the right internal temperature is crucial for several reasons:

  • Food Safety: Cooking ham to the right temperature ensures that any harmful bacteria, such as Trichinella, are killed. Trichinella can cause trichinosis, a serious foodborne illness.
  • Quality and Texture: Overcooking can make the ham dry and tough, while undercooking can leave it raw and unsafe. The right temperature ensures that the ham is cooked uniformly, retaining its moisture and tenderness.
  • Flavor: The internal temperature can also affect the flavor of the ham. Cooking it to the right temperature can enhance the caramelization of the glaze and bring out the natural flavors of the meat.

Tools for Checking Internal Temperature

To ensure that the ham reaches the ideal internal temperature, it’s essential to use the right tools. A food thermometer is the most accurate way to check the internal temperature of the ham. There are different types of thermometers available, including:

  • Instant-read thermometers: These provide quick and accurate readings and are ideal for checking the temperature of the ham during the cooking process.
  • Oven-safe thermometers: These can be left in the ham while it cooks in the oven, providing a continuous reading of the internal temperature.

Tips for Using a Food Thermometer

  • Insert the thermometer into the thickest part of the ham, avoiding any fat or bone.
  • Make sure the thermometer is not touching any bones or the pan, as this can give a false reading.
  • Wait for a few seconds until the temperature stabilizes before taking a reading.

What is the ideal internal temperature for cooking ham to perfection?

The ideal internal temperature for cooking ham to perfection depends on the type of ham being cooked. For a whole ham, the internal temperature should reach 140°F (60°C) to ensure food safety and evenly cooked meat. It’s essential to use a meat thermometer to check the internal temperature, especially when cooking a large or whole ham. This is because the temperature can vary throughout the meat, and inserting the thermometer into the thickest part of the ham will provide an accurate reading.

To achieve the perfect internal temperature, it’s crucial to cook the ham at the right temperature and for the right amount of time. Preheat the oven to 325°F (160°C) and place the ham on a rack in a roasting pan. If glazing the ham, apply the glaze during the last 20-30 minutes of cooking to prevent it from burning. It’s also important to let the ham rest for 10-15 minutes before slicing to allow the juices to redistribute, resulting in a tender and juicy texture.

How do I determine the right cooking time for my ham based on its size and type?

Determining the right cooking time for your ham depends on several factors, including its size, type, and whether it’s bone-in or boneless. A general rule of thumb is to cook a whole ham for 15-20 minutes per pound, or until it reaches the ideal internal temperature. For a boneless ham, cook for 12-15 minutes per pound, while a bone-in ham may require 18-22 minutes per pound. It’s also important to consider the type of ham, as some may have specific cooking instructions, such as a spiral-cut ham or a country-style ham.

To ensure the ham is cooked to perfection, it’s essential to check its internal temperature regularly, especially during the last 30 minutes of cooking. Use a meat thermometer to insert into the thickest part of the ham, avoiding any fat or bone. If the ham is not yet at the ideal internal temperature, continue cooking in 10-15 minute increments until it reaches the desired temperature. Keep in mind that cooking times may vary depending on the oven and the ham’s specific characteristics, so it’s always better to err on the side of caution and cook the ham until it’s slightly above the recommended internal temperature.

Can I cook a ham at a lower temperature to prevent drying out?

Cooking a ham at a lower temperature can help prevent it from drying out, especially if it’s a leaner or smaller ham. In fact, cooking a ham at a lower temperature can result in a more tender and juicy texture. To cook a ham at a lower temperature, preheat the oven to 275-300°F (135-150°C) and cook for a longer period, typically 20-25 minutes per pound. This method is ideal for smaller or boneless hams, as it helps retain moisture and prevent overcooking.

However, it’s essential to note that cooking a ham at a lower temperature may require more time and attention. It’s crucial to monitor the ham’s internal temperature regularly to avoid undercooking or overcooking. Additionally, if using a glaze, it may not caramelize as well at lower temperatures, so it’s best to apply the glaze during the last 30 minutes of cooking. By cooking the ham at a lower temperature, you can achieve a deliciously tender and juicy texture, perfect for special occasions or everyday meals.

What is the difference between cooking a bone-in and boneless ham?

Cooking a bone-in ham versus a boneless ham can result in different textures and flavors. A bone-in ham typically has more fat and connective tissue, which can make it more tender and juicy when cooked. The bone also acts as an insulator, helping to retain heat and moisture within the meat. On the other hand, a boneless ham is often leaner and more prone to drying out if overcooked. However, boneless hams can be easier to slice and serve, making them a popular choice for many cooks.

When cooking a bone-in ham, it’s essential to score the fat in a diamond pattern to allow the glaze to penetrate the meat. This also helps the fat render and crisp up, creating a deliciously caramelized exterior. For a boneless ham, it’s best to cook it at a slightly lower temperature to prevent drying out. Additionally, using a meat thermometer is crucial to ensure the ham reaches the ideal internal temperature, regardless of whether it’s bone-in or boneless. By understanding the differences between cooking a bone-in and boneless ham, you can achieve a perfectly cooked ham that suits your taste and preferences.

How do I prevent my ham from drying out during cooking?

Preventing a ham from drying out during cooking requires attention to temperature, cooking time, and moisture. One of the most effective ways to keep a ham moist is to cook it with a glaze or a layer of fat, such as brown sugar, honey, or mustard. This helps to lock in moisture and add flavor to the meat. Another method is to cover the ham with foil or a lid during cooking, which helps retain heat and moisture. It’s also essential to avoid overcooking the ham, as this can cause it to dry out and become tough.

To add extra moisture to the ham, you can baste it with pan juices or a mixture of stock and spices every 20-30 minutes during cooking. This helps to keep the meat moist and flavorful. Additionally, using a meat thermometer to monitor the internal temperature can help prevent overcooking. If the ham starts to dry out, you can try covering it with foil or increasing the frequency of basting. By taking these steps, you can ensure a tender, juicy, and deliciously cooked ham that’s perfect for any occasion.

Can I cook a ham in a slow cooker or Instant Pot?

Yes, you can cook a ham in a slow cooker or Instant Pot, which can be a convenient and hands-off way to achieve a perfectly cooked ham. To cook a ham in a slow cooker, place the ham in the cooker and add your choice of glaze or seasonings. Cook on low for 8-10 hours or on high for 4-6 hours, or until the ham reaches the ideal internal temperature. For an Instant Pot, place the ham in the pot and add a small amount of liquid, such as stock or water. Cook on high pressure for 10-15 minutes per pound, followed by a 10-minute natural release.

Cooking a ham in a slow cooker or Instant Pot can result in a tender and juicy texture, as the low heat and moisture help to break down the connective tissue. However, it’s essential to monitor the ham’s internal temperature to ensure it reaches the ideal temperature. Additionally, if using a glaze, you may need to apply it during the last 30 minutes of cooking to prevent it from burning or becoming too caramelized. By cooking a ham in a slow cooker or Instant Pot, you can achieve a deliciously cooked ham with minimal effort and attention, perfect for busy cooks or special occasions.

How do I store and reheat a cooked ham to maintain its quality and safety?

To store a cooked ham, it’s essential to let it cool to room temperature before refrigerating or freezing. Wrap the ham tightly in plastic wrap or aluminum foil and place it in a covered container to prevent drying out. Cooked ham can be stored in the refrigerator for up to 5 days or frozen for up to 2 months. When reheating a cooked ham, it’s crucial to heat it to an internal temperature of 140°F (60°C) to ensure food safety.

To reheat a cooked ham, you can use the oven, microwave, or slow cooker. For oven reheating, wrap the ham in foil and heat at 325°F (160°C) for 10-15 minutes per pound, or until the ham reaches the ideal internal temperature. For microwave reheating, wrap the ham in a damp paper towel and heat on high for 30-60 seconds per pound, checking the temperature regularly to avoid overcooking.
